Pianos: Showroom programs back-to-back indie, rock and experimental nights with a steady stream of three-band bills and themed parties. Lineups mix local acts and touring bands, from jangly guitar sets to synth-driven goth nights and noisy punk bills. The space feels compact and close to the stage, good for getting up close with the performers. Shows run late and often attract a mixed, music-first crowd.
